How to Invest in the S&P 500 in 2025: Index Funds and ETFs

The S&P 500 is a well-known stock market index — an index isn’t an investment itself, but a list of companies that are related in some way or otherwise grouped together. You can’t directly invest in a stock market index like the S&P 500, but you can invest in an index fund or exchange-traded fund that tracks the index.

The easiest way to invest in the S&P 500

An S&P 500 index fund or ETF is the simplest way to invest in the index. These funds aim to replicate the returns of the S&P 500 by tracking it, offering investors exposure to S&P 500 companies without the effort involved in purchasing the individual stock of each company.
